Transaction bb9c64959d26557a75f44758349a1596c088ca95ab0a45e67b618d8b35e593a6

2 Input
1 Outputs
  • bb9c64959d26557a75f44758349a1596c088ca95ab0a45e67b618d8b35e593a6:0
  • value  3425112
    address  148qfQEwk4NoNEUCRA6WMRSc1ZupCLPb5T